Lexicon G. Abbott-Smith

Voor meer informatie: G. Abbott-Smith's A Manual Greek Lexicon of the New Testament (New York: Scribner's, 1922)

** καίτοι (= καί τοι, and so also written in cl.), concessive particle [in LXX: IV Mac 2:6*;] and yet, although: Ac 14:17; c. ptcp., He 4:3.†

Henry George Liddell, Robert Scott, A Greek-English Lexicon

Voor meer informatie: Henry George Liddell, Robert Scott, A Greek-English Lexicon (1940)

καί τοι,
  and indeed, and further, frequently in Homerus Epicus with one or more words between, Ilias Homerus Epicus “Illiad” 1.426, al.; καὶ σύ τοι Euripides Tragicus “Medea” 344 ; καὶ τἆλλά τοι Xenophon Historicus “Institutio Cyri (Cyropaedia)” 7.3.10: once in Homerus Epicus as one word, Ilias Homerus Epicus “Illiad” 13.267.
__II after Homerus Epicus usually, and yet, to mark an objection introduced by the speaker himself, frequently in Rhetorical questions, καίτοι τί φημ; Aeschylus Tragicus “Prometheus Vinctus” 101 ; κ. τί φων; Sophocles Tragicus “Oedipus Coloneus” 1132, compare Isocrates Orator 4.99, etc. : without a question, κ. φύγοιμ᾽ ἄν Euripides Tragicus “Cyclops” 480; κ. καὶ τοῦτο.. Demosthenes Orator 4.12, 18.122: strengthened, καίτοι γ᾽ Aristophanes Comicus “Acharnenses” 611, Euripides Tragicus “Fragmenta” 953.10, Xenophon Historicus “Memorabilia” 1.2.3, Philo Judaeus 1.274, etc.: mostly separated, καίτοι.. γε Euripides Tragicus “Orestes” 77, Aristophanes Comicus “Ranae” 43, Xenophon Historicus “Memorabilia” 3.12.7, etc. (καίτοι is falsa lectio in Aeschylus Tragicus “Eumenides” 849) ; so καίτοι περ variant in Herodotus Historicus 8.53.
__III with a participle, much like{καίπερ}, Simonides Lyricus 5.9, Aristophanes Comicus “Ecclesiazusae” 159, Plato Philosophus “Respublica” 511d, Polybius Historicus 22.8.13, Philodemus Gadarensis Epigrammaticus “Ir.” p.22 W., Lucianus Sophista “Alex.” 3 : once in the Attic dialect Oratt., Lysias Orator 31.34; also καίτοι γε διαχλευάζων Plato Philosophus “Axiochus” 364b.
